About American Home Shield
American Home Shield is a home warranty provider that offers service plans throughout the contiguous United States. It offers three home warranty plan options, priced from $29.99 to $89.99 per month, with either a $100 or $125 service fee. In addition to normal wear and tear, plans cover breakdowns from rust, insufficient maintenance and faulty repairs, which are often excluded from home warranty coverage.
- Three plan options
- High coverage limits
- 30-day workmanship guarantee
- Covers rust, corrosion and sediment damage
- Relatively high service fees
- Not available in all states
